Einzelnen Beitrag anzeigen

Benutzerbild von himitsu
himitsu
Online

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
43.142 Beiträge
 
Delphi 12 Athens
 
#3

AW: Funktion/Prozedur abbrechen?

  Alt 20. Apr 2015, 08:38
Ich sehe hier nirgendwo einen Grund für ein Exit, oder Dergleichen.
Du mußt einfach nur die "ELSE" richtig verschachteln.

Oder siehe Sir Rufo und du wirfst eine Exception.

www.if-schleife.de




Wobei die Codeformatierung auch nicht sonderlich gut ist, vorallem bezüglich der Einrückung.

Hier sieht es so aus, als wenn du was Anderes machen willst, als im Code da steht.
Delphi-Quellcode:
begin
    if Edit2.Text <= Edit1.Text then
        maxpunktzahl:=StrToInt(Edit1.Text);
        schülerpunkte:=StrToInt(Edit2.Text);
        Minpunkte[1]:=(maxpunktzahl/100)*96;
Zitat:
Edit2.Text > Edit1.Text
In den Edits stehen doch bestimmt Zahlen drin?
Wenn ja, dann ist ein Stringvergleich nicht sonderlich gut, denn '20' ist größer als '100'.
Garbage Collector ... Delphianer erzeugen keinen Müll, also brauchen sie auch keinen Müllsucher.
my Delphi wish list : BugReports/FeatureRequests

Geändert von himitsu (20. Apr 2015 um 08:48 Uhr)
  Mit Zitat antworten Zitat